Hey plugin authors! Welcome to DigestHub, the batch email digest scheduler from Quillmere Labs. Your plugin registers a digest template, and our scheduler batches sends at the cadence you declare — hourly, daily, or the ever-popular "whenever Tuesday feels right" weekly slot. To test locally, spin up the sandbox with DIGEST_SANDBOX=true and a cron window of your choosing. The sandbox mailer needs an API credential, which you set on the next line.

env line for fafof-fahag: LEDGER_TOKEN5=f8790

# Runbook: Hunting leaked file descriptors in Quillgate

When the `fd_open` gauge climbs steadily between deploys, suspect a leak rather than load. First confirm on a single pod: exec in and count entries under `/proc/1/fd`, noting how many are sockets in CLOSE_WAIT versus regular files. Capture two snapshots ten minutes apart before restarting anything — we need the delta for the postmortem. Reproduce locally with the Marbury load harness, which requires the service running with the following configuration values.

settings of yagep-bajog:
[istdor]
port = 4000
region = south-2
host = istdor.qorvelcorp.internal
timeout_ms = 5000
retries = 5

## Step 4: Cut over the user module

Once the Brindle user service is deployed, flip reads first and leave writes on the monolith for one full business day. Watch the shadow-comparison dashboard for mismatches above 0.1%. If mismatches spike, roll back reads immediately; the monolith remains authoritative until step 6. Before flipping, confirm the service is running with the expected configuration, reproduced here for reference.

service settings:
PRAIX_LOG_LEVEL=error
PRAIX_METRICS_HOST=metrics.praix.qorvelcorp.corp
PRAIX_POOL_SIZE=16

**Vendor note: Inkmill markdown pipeline**

Rendering for Parchway docs is outsourced to Inkmill under an annual contract, renewing each March. They handle sanitization and PDF export; we own the upload queue. SLA: 4-hour response on rendering failures. Escalate only after two failed retries. Their support desk is reachable at the address below.

billing contact of hahaf-baguf = zorael.tammir.jorius@sivrelhq.internal